Fairfield High School is a mid-sized high school in Fairfield, Iowa, enrolling 442 students.
At 14.3:1, its student-teacher ratio sits close to the Iowa median, within a few percentage points of the 14.8:1 state norm, neither notably crowded nor notably small.
Its free-meal eligibility rate of 37.0% lands close to the Iowa typical range, neither a high- nor low-need campus by this measure.
Enrollment of 442 puts it in the larger third of Iowa schools by headcount.
Its Resource Investment Index lands in the lower third of 1,322 scored Iowa schools.
Against 377 statewide peers matched on enrollment and economic need, it ranks mid-pack at #261.
Its student body is predominantly White (82% of enrollment) (diversity index 32/100).
On the academic-pipeline side it reports 4 Advanced Placement courses.
Counselor coverage is strong, about 221 students per counselor, inside the American School Counselor Association's recommended 250:1.
Chronic absenteeism is elevated: 47.1% of students missed 10% or more of school days (2021-22 Civil Rights Data Collection).
The federal civil-rights collection also records 6 expulsions at this campus for 2021-22.
Fairfield Comm School District also operates Fairfield Middle School (410 students) and Pence Elementary (317 students) alongside Fairfield High School.
